Abstract
The utility model provides a kind of upper air inlet burner, burner main body including being provided with gas seat, multiple nozzles are provided on the gas seat, there is spacing between the nozzle and the inlet end of burner main body, the burner main body is provided with center ejector pipe, it is set to the outer ring ejector pipe of center ejector pipe two sides, centre porosity and outer ring stomata, the outer ring ejector pipe connects outer ring stomata, the center ejector pipe connects centre porosity, tortuous mixed air cavity is additionally provided between the outer ring ejector pipe and outer ring stomata, the setting for using double ejector pipes to connect with tortuous mixing chamber is to improve the inlet of gas intake and primary air, extend incorporation time and the path of air and combustion gas, it improves mixed effect and then improves efficiency of combustion, it is the excellent and of fine quality product of money structure.

Specific embodiment
As follows in conjunction with attached drawing, application scheme is further described:
Embodiment:
Referring to attached drawing 1-2, a kind of upper air inlet burner, the burner main body 1 including being provided with gas seat 2 is arranged on the gas seat 2
There are multiple nozzles, between the nozzle and the inlet end of burner main body 1 there is spacing to form mixed gas with preliminary mixing air,
Outer ring ejector pipe 12, the centre porosity that the burner main body 1 is provided with center ejector pipe 11, is set to 11 two sides of center ejector pipe
14 and outer ring stomata 13, the outer ring ejector pipe 12 connects outer ring stomata 13, and the center ejector pipe 11 connects centre porosity
14, it is additionally provided with tortuous mixed air cavity 17 between the outer ring ejector pipe 12 and outer ring stomata 13, is drawn by the way that two outer rings are arranged
Pipe 12 is penetrated to improve the soakage of fuel gas supply and primary air and then improve combustion efficiency and efficiency of combustion.
Further, it is provided with the first air inlet 21 and the second air inlet 22 on the gas seat 2, the nozzle includes center
Nozzle 23 and outer ring nozzle 24, first air inlet 21 connect central nozzle 23, and second air inlet 22 connects outer ring spray
Mouth 24.
Further, the outer ring nozzle 24 is corresponding with outer ring ejector pipe 12, the central nozzle 23 and center ejector pipe
11 is corresponding.
Further, the central nozzle 23 is different with the level height of outer ring nozzle 24, the corresponding center injection
The inlet end of pipe 11 and the inlet end of outer ring ejector pipe 12 be not in same level more to fill in different level upper air
Divide the air using solid space, improves air imbibed quantity.
Further, the outer ring ejector pipe 12 and mixed air cavity 17 form J-type and move road to form tortuous mixed gas
Diameter extends incorporation time, and then improves mixed effect.
Further, it is provided with distributor mounting base 15 in the burner main body 1, is arranged in the distributor mounting base 15
There is surrounding edge to install distributor, multiple arcs recess portion 16 is provided on the surrounding edge to form limit, so that distributor installation is more
Adding securely prevents from shifting.
